It is easily possible to fly all day long when the wind remains constant in strength and direction. A 300 ft hill when the air is of the right buoyancy and wind speed will provide as much as 800 ft of height gain in which the pilot can swoop and soar.

If this is the case then the glider, kept within this rising lift-band, will ascend until an equilibrium is reached where the speed of descent matches the rising of the air. Note, the air must be rising faster than the glider descends through the air.
